…They are found in seawater, marine mud, fresh water, sludge, and other places with a high content of sulfur compounds, and oxidize substrates such as hydrogen sulfide (sulfide), solid sulfur, sulfite, thiosulfate, and polythionates. Beggiatoa and Thiothrix , which have long been widely known as sulfur bacteria, are made up of rod-shaped cells that gather together to form filaments, and in the presence of hydrogen sulfide, they oxidize it and accumulate sulfur in their bodies. They are often found in ditches. … From Beggiatoa…It is relatively large for a bacterium, and because it forms filaments and moves in a gliding manner, it is said to be closer in phylogeny to the blue-green algae Oscillatoria than to bacteria. It is closely related to the sulfur bacteria Achromatium , Thiobacillus , and Thiothrix , and is classified as the Beggiatoales.
